Here we are with another selection of free Xbox games you can play this weekend.

As you’ve probably already guessed, these six free games are part of Xbox Free Play Days.

Out of the six games on offer, two are actually going to stick around for a lot longer than the typical weekend time limit.

Advert

The two Ubisoft titles will be available until 12 December.

Prepare for a thrilling ride in The Crew Motorfest

Without further ado, let’s get into the games available:

  • DRIFTCE – prove you have what it takes to beat the very best in this authentic racing simulation experience. Just make sure to hang on!
  • MX vs ATV Legends – you got that need for speed but prefer bikes? This thrilling game has you covered, complete with stunning open world environments.
  • Naruto To Boruto: Shinobi Striker – it's time for you to show your love of all things Naruto by battling it out against other online teams. Can you win?
  • Parcel Corps – say goodbye to the office and hello to the open road (kind of) as you become a freelance bicycle messenger.
  • The Crew Motorfest - described as the “ultimate gathering for car lovers”, this Ubisoft title isn’t one you should let pass you by.
  • Tom Clancy's Rainbow Six Siege - jump back into the action of this acclaimed franchise by starting a new Tom Clancy adventure. Prepare for an intense experience from start to finish.

You all know the drill by now, but, as always, we like to be thorough just in case.

You need to be a member of one of the three Xbox Game Pass tiers to be able to access Free Play Days.

Advert

Furthermore, all of the titles listed are currently discounted should you realise you actually want to keep playing once these 48 hours are up.

Just select the game you want and start playing.
